Understanding Cellular Senescence and Its Impact
Cellular senescence is a complex biological process where cells enter a state of irreversible growth arrest. While beneficial in certain contexts, such as wound healing and tumor suppression, the accumulation of senescent cells over time contributes significantly to aging and the development of age-related diseases. These cells, often referred to as 'zombie cells,' remain metabolically active and secrete inflammatory factors (SASP), which can impair tissue function and promote chronic inflammation. Addressing this cellular burden is a primary goal of many anti-aging strategies.
The Role of FOXO4-DRI in Cellular Rejuvenation
FOXO4-DRI distinguishes itself through its specific mechanism of action. It acts as a blocker of the FOXO4 protein's interaction with p53, a critical protein involved in cell cycle control and apoptosis. By disrupting this interaction, FOXO4-DRI facilitates the safe elimination of senescent cells through programmed cell death (apoptosis). This selective action is crucial, as it ensures that healthy, functional cells are not affected, thereby preserving tissue integrity and function. This targeted approach makes FOXO4-DRI a promising candidate for cellular rejuvenation therapies.
